新聞中心
本文由創(chuàng)新互聯(lián)(www.cdcxhl.com)小編為大家整理,本文主要介紹了你為什么學(xué)python的相關(guān)知識(shí),希望對(duì)你有一定的參考價(jià)值和幫助,記得關(guān)注和收藏網(wǎng)址哦!

你為什么學(xué)python?
第一,當(dāng)然是 "人生苦短,我用Python "。回到正題,為什么要學(xué)Python?隨著深度學(xué)習(xí)技術(shù)的成熟,AI人工智能正從前沿技術(shù)逐漸走向普及。Python已經(jīng)成為開(kāi)發(fā)人工智能的最佳語(yǔ)言。簡(jiǎn)單易學(xué),開(kāi)發(fā)效率高??梢哉f(shuō)是目前市面上最簡(jiǎn)單、最豐富、最通用的編程語(yǔ)言。
在云計(jì)算、大數(shù)據(jù)分析、人工智能、物聯(lián)網(wǎng)等領(lǐng)域,Python應(yīng)用無(wú)處不在。而且公司急需Python人才,但是掌握Python技術(shù)的人才并不多,導(dǎo)致公司急需Python開(kāi)發(fā)人員。
既然Python這么厲害,那我們應(yīng)該怎么學(xué)習(xí)Python呢?了解 amp的Python學(xué)習(xí)路線;"如鵬網(wǎng) "可以作為學(xué)習(xí)的技術(shù)路線圖作為參考。1.Python基礎(chǔ)
2.數(shù)據(jù)庫(kù)開(kāi)發(fā)技術(shù)
美國(guó)有什么著名的APP在流行么?
3.w有什么著名的應(yīng)用程序在很流行嗎?答案太多了,比我們表面想的多得多,而且都是必須的。
國(guó)內(nèi)app都是頂級(jí)的,多是吃喝玩樂(lè)。你說(shuō)反抗,你就反抗。如果你反抗,你的生活就會(huì)恢復(fù)正常。
美國(guó)的軟件都是底層的,這是app運(yùn)行的基礎(chǔ)和前提。
操作系統(tǒng)android,ios,windows…等等用來(lái)支撐各種app,各種應(yīng)用系統(tǒng)(os),幾乎都是美國(guó)人做的。沒(méi)有os就沒(méi)有辦法運(yùn)行app,每一部手機(jī)電腦都必須安裝,這是應(yīng)用最廣泛的。如果現(xiàn)在反抗,手機(jī)電腦就成廢鐵了!
Android app的java語(yǔ)言、蘋(píng)果ios的Objective-C語(yǔ)言、SQL、SDK等各種數(shù)據(jù)庫(kù)開(kāi)發(fā)語(yǔ)言、各種數(shù)據(jù)交互接口API等編程語(yǔ)言和支持工具。還有HTML,C#。Net,js,PHP,VB,人工智能AI語(yǔ)音...不是制造的。
集成開(kāi)發(fā)環(huán)境(IDE)是用于提供程序開(kāi)發(fā)環(huán)境的應(yīng)用程序,包括代碼編輯器、編譯器、調(diào)試器和圖形用戶界面等工具。它集成了代碼編寫(xiě)、分析、編譯和調(diào)試等功能。所有具有這種特性的軟件或軟件包(組)都可以稱(chēng)為集成開(kāi)發(fā)環(huán)境。比如微軟 s V。Isual Studio系列,Borland的C Builder,Delphi系列等。這個(gè)程序可以獨(dú)立運(yùn)行,也可以和其他程序一起使用。IDE多用于開(kāi)發(fā)HTML應(yīng)用軟件。比如很多人用IDE(比如HomeSite,DreamWeaver等。)設(shè)計(jì)網(wǎng)站的時(shí)候,因?yàn)楹芏嗳蝿?wù)會(huì)自動(dòng)生成。
辦公軟件和圖文音響軟件是著名的辦公系列,包括最常用的Word、Excel、PowerPoint、Outlook、Acc
如何才能寫(xiě)出高質(zhì)量的代碼?
的java開(kāi)發(fā)工程師,我對(duì)這個(gè)問(wèn)題有一些感觸,所以我想談?wù)勎覍?duì)java開(kāi)發(fā)的一些看法,純屬個(gè)人觀點(diǎn),我不 不喜歡被輕噴!什么樣的代碼是優(yōu)質(zhì)代碼,或者說(shuō)優(yōu)質(zhì)代碼的特點(diǎn)?在我看來(lái),主要在于可讀性和易擴(kuò)展。
首先,我覺(jué)得最重要的是要有可讀性。為什么這么說(shuō)?相信做過(guò)開(kāi)發(fā)的朋友都知道,互聯(lián)網(wǎng)公司的離職率還是比較高的??赡艹霈F(xiàn)的情況是,領(lǐng)導(dǎo)突然告訴你,你要去交接某個(gè)同事的工作,而交接過(guò)程中的大致情況主要是業(yè)務(wù)流程和功能模塊,所以有很大概率你贏了 不要逐行閱讀代碼。如果項(xiàng)目正常工作,沒(méi)有問(wèn)題,沒(méi)有需求變更(需求大概率會(huì)變更),就是大家好,大家好。如果有問(wèn)題或者需求變化,或者以前同事的那些模塊,你就要啃代碼了。這時(shí)候代碼的可讀性就很重要了。你可以想象一下,沒(méi)有一個(gè)注釋?zhuān)粋€(gè)方法幾百行,if/《計(jì)算機(jī)程序的構(gòu)造和解釋》提到,代碼是為人寫(xiě)的,不是為機(jī)器寫(xiě)的,而是可以被計(jì)算機(jī)執(zhí)行的。如果代碼是為機(jī)器寫(xiě)的,那么可以由機(jī)器使用匯編語(yǔ)言或者機(jī)器語(yǔ)言(二進(jìn)制)直接執(zhí)行。所以代碼一定要通俗易懂。高質(zhì)量代碼的好處:
好的代碼讀起來(lái)很賞心悅目,比如spring,mybatis等java中的框架。當(dāng)你閱讀源代碼時(shí),你常常會(huì)感到驚訝。代碼還能這么寫(xiě)!
高質(zhì)量意味著低維護(hù)成本和穩(wěn)定運(yùn)行。
高質(zhì)量意味著強(qiáng)大的可擴(kuò)展性和業(yè)務(wù)發(fā)展的便利性。
如何寫(xiě)出高質(zhì)量的代碼?對(duì)于做java的,我建議去看看《阿里巴巴Java開(kāi)發(fā)手冊(cè)》。
從Java開(kāi)發(fā)者的角度,手冊(cè)分為編程規(guī)范、異常日志、單元測(cè)試、安全規(guī)范、MySQL數(shù)據(jù)庫(kù)、工程結(jié)構(gòu)、設(shè)計(jì)規(guī)范七個(gè)維度,再根據(jù)內(nèi)容特點(diǎn)細(xì)分為若干個(gè)二級(jí)子目錄。根據(jù)約束力和過(guò)錯(cuò)敏感度,規(guī)定分為強(qiáng)制性、推薦性和參考性三類(lèi)。對(duì)于協(xié)議項(xiàng)的擴(kuò)展信息, "描述 "適當(dāng)擴(kuò)展和解釋協(xié)議; amp提倡什么樣的編碼和實(shí)現(xiàn)?"正面例子 " "反例 "舉例說(shuō)明需要防范的雷區(qū),以及真實(shí)的錯(cuò)誤案例。摘自echo 6-@ . com amp;;最后推薦,阿里巴巴 的代碼規(guī)范掃描插件,以IDEA為例,安裝如下
按如下使用:
其實(shí)echo 3-@ . com amp;;的編程語(yǔ)言是相通的。在時(shí)間有限的情況下,一個(gè)或幾個(gè)小事件的訓(xùn)練可以幫助你快速理清編程思路。在此,我向書(shū)名擁有者推薦《《我的第一本編程書(shū)》》這本書(shū)。
這本書(shū)通過(guò)一個(gè)落下的方塊排列整齊的游戲,講解了一個(gè)小游戲項(xiàng)目所涉及的編程知識(shí)。如果對(duì)編程語(yǔ)言不精通,可以先通過(guò)本書(shū)提供的案例,用專(zhuān)門(mén)的編程語(yǔ)言體驗(yàn)項(xiàng)目過(guò)程,學(xué)習(xí)小項(xiàng)目的編程思路,了解各種知識(shí)點(diǎn)的用途。
具體到編程語(yǔ)言的學(xué)習(xí),下面是一些比較適合初學(xué)者學(xué)習(xí)的編程語(yǔ)言書(shū)籍。希望能對(duì)題主有所幫助。
c語(yǔ)言是程序員入門(mén)語(yǔ)言,也是很多大學(xué)的第一門(mén)編程課程。如果學(xué)科想以后從事編程方面的工作,學(xué)習(xí)C語(yǔ)言是很有必要的?!丁氨哭k法”學(xué)C語(yǔ)言》寫(xiě)的這本書(shū)更適合初學(xué)者。
這本書(shū)的內(nèi)容很容易理解。它通過(guò)52個(gè)練習(xí)講解C語(yǔ)言的相關(guān)知識(shí),每個(gè)練習(xí)都配有一個(gè)視頻,更方便讀者操作,保證程序的正確運(yùn)行。
如果你覺(jué)得echo 8-@ . com amp;;的書(shū)可以接受,可以試試看echo 10-@ . com amp;;再次挑戰(zhàn)你的能力。
主要是c語(yǔ)言用于小規(guī)模程序的開(kāi)發(fā),對(duì)于計(jì)算量大的程序,C是更好的選擇。不過(guò)初中程序員學(xué)c還是比較難的,如果題主想做更深入的研究,可以試試echo 11-@ . com amp;;看看你是否能走得更遠(yuǎn)。
除了C/C,Java和Python是目前主流的編程語(yǔ)言。通過(guò)學(xué)習(xí)《漫畫(huà)面向?qū)ο缶幊蘆ava語(yǔ)言版》、《教孩子學(xué)編程(Python語(yǔ)言版)》和《Python趣味編程入門(mén)》的一些簡(jiǎn)單案例,作者可以了解不同編程語(yǔ)言的特點(diǎn)。
新聞標(biāo)題:你為什么學(xué)python?(美國(guó)有什么著名的APP在流行么?)
文章URL:http://m.fisionsoft.com.cn/article/cdphhhd.html


咨詢
建站咨詢
